Network Engineer Salary in San Rafael, CA — Complete Guide

Median Salary Overview

The median salary for a network engineer in San Rafael, CA is $204,511 per year, adjusted for the local cost of living index of 155. This figure reflects typical earnings for experienced professionals in this role, considering San Rafael's unique economic conditions.

Salary Range and Experience Levels

Entry-level network engineer professionals in San Rafael can expect to earn around $120,633 annually. As professionals gain experience, salaries typically increase, with senior-level network engineers earning approximately $278,964 per year. This represents a 131% increase from entry to senior level.

Cost of Living Adjustment

San Rafael's cost of living index of 155 significantly impacts salary comparisons. As a higher cost-of-living city, salaries in San Rafael are adjusted accordingly. This means that while the nominal salary may appear higher or lower than the national average of $103,080, the actual purchasing power must be considered in context.

Housing and Affordability

A significant portion of a network engineer's salary in San Rafael typically goes toward housing. With a 1-bedroom apartment averaging $2,200 per month, housing represents about 12.9% of median salary. Financial experts generally recommend keeping housing expenses below 30% of gross income.
